328 Katong Laksa + The Cider Pit

Posted on Tuesday, May 28, 2013

Those who know me well will know what a weakness I have for laksa, all kinds, as long as it has hum (cockles) in it. I made the long and arduous trip all the way to the East to meet Mr Osman Khan to get my hands on the bonafide stuff at 328 Katong Laksa. Yum! Ordered too big a bowl (Medium sized at $5.00, personally a Small would have been suffice, but since I came all the way...) and of course I had extra cockles. Half the fun of laksa is really in the hum, and much fun did I have!

Later, Os introduced me to a new find in the east - The Cider Pit, which is newly opened and apparently has the widest range of ciders in Singapore! The place was completely full, but luckily we were early and got a seat. We both had the cider on tap, Westons Country Perry (a light and sweet one) for me and Westons Scrumpy (cloudy, rich and fruity) for Os! I personally liked mine a lot, and when I tried to order another one, it was all sold out! At $10.00 for a pint, and $5.00 for half a pint, it's really quite good value for money. Wish they had a branch nearer my place, then I'd be drinking cider all the time!

328 Katong Laksa 
51 East Coast Road

The Cider Pit 
328 Joo Chiat Road
